1977 Fiat 127 vs. 2012 Ford Ka

To start off, 2012 Ford Ka is newer by 35 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 1977 Fiat 127.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 1977 Fiat 127 would be higher. At 1,297 cc (4 cylinders), 2012 Ford Ka is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 1977 Fiat 127 (70 HP @ 6500 RPM) has 2 more horse power than 2012 Ford Ka. (68 HP @ 5500 RPM). In normal driving conditions, 1977 Fiat 127 should accelerate faster than 2012 Ford Ka.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 2012 Ford Ka weights approximately 112 kg more than 1977 Fiat 127.

Because 1977 Fiat 127 is rear wheel drive (RWD), it offers better handling in dry conditions; in addition, if you are looking to drift, it will be much easier to do with 1977 Fiat 127. However, in wet, icy, snow, or gravel driving conditions, 2012 Ford Ka, being front wheel drive (FWD), will offer much better control with better grip.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. Let's talk about torque, 2012 Ford Ka (106 Nm @ 3000 RPM) has 23 more torque (in Nm) than 1977 Fiat 127. (83 Nm @ 4500 RPM). This means 2012 Ford Ka will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 1977 Fiat 127.

Compare all specifications:

1977 Fiat 127 2012 Ford Ka
Make Fiat Ford
Model 127 Ka
Year Released 1977 2012
Engine Position Front Front
Engine Size 1047 cc 1297 cc
Engine Cylinders 4 cylinders 4 cylinders
Engine Type in-line in-line
Horse Power 70 HP 68 HP
Engine RPM 6500 RPM 5500 RPM
Torque 83 Nm 106 Nm
Torque RPM 4500 RPM 3000 RPM
Engine Bore Size 76 mm 74 mm
Engine Stroke Size 57.8 mm 75.5 mm
Engine Compression Ratio 9.8:1 10.2:1
Top Speed 161 km/hour 167 km/hour
Drive Type Rear Front
Transmission Type Manual Manual
Number of Seats 4 seats 4 seats
Number of Doors 3 doors 3 doors
Vehicle Weight 775 kg 887 kg
Vehicle Length 3650 mm 3630 mm
Vehicle Width 1540 mm 1830 mm
Vehicle Height 1370 mm 1360 mm
Wheelbase Size 2230 mm 2450 mm
Fuel Tank Capacity 30 L 40 L
